Do fixer upper clients keep Clint's furniture?

As is the case for most HGTV shows, the clients don't typically get to keep the furniture or decorations. Their budget usually only allots for renovations. According to former Fixer Upper client Jaime Ferguson, the clients can pick what they want to keep at the end, but it's an added cost.

What is the most expensive part of a kitchen remodel?

The most expensive element of any kitchen remodel is usually the cabinets, which on average cost upwards of $15,000. In second place are new appliances, costing on average around Find more information $8,200. The countertops are the next greatest expense, generally costing just under $6,000.

As an example, the maximum LTV on a typical household home mortgage is 95%, whereas the maximum LTV for a let to purchase or get to allow home loan is 85% and also vacation allowed home mortgages are typically just available as much as 75-80% LTV. The initial thing to consider if you wish to remortgage to get a 2nd property is how much equity you presently have in your residence. Remortgaging your house to get an additional property is a common method of elevating money for people that are seeking to purchase buy to let or to purchase a 2nd house.
